Transaction 16d62f1a88856a4c7edba3cce19cf875e976b41c95114ad1ae4ce718b2ba6099
1 Input
1 Output
-
16d62f1a88856a4c7edba3cce19cf875e976b41c95114ad1ae4ce718b2ba6099:0
- value
- 33531733
- script pubkey
- OP_0 OP_PUSHBYTES_20 c872e05e663375d2c01447bfa4da8658e13ac365
- address
- bc1qepewqhnxxd6a9sq5g7l6fk5xtrsn4sm93nl3uu